Lady Gaga And Oreo Announce 'Chromatica' Limited-Edition Cookies

by Rudy Sanchez on 12/02/2020 | 2 Minute Read

Despite a seven-week delay, recording artist and occasional wearer of meat, Lady Gaga, finally released her sixth studio album Chromatica. However, the same circumstances that delayed her latest banger have also denied her little monsters from listening to it performed live or dancing with reckless abandon in the club. 

You'll have to wait until at least next summer for Gaga to wow fans with a stadium-level spectacle in support of the record, but in the meantime, Oreo has them covered with a new cookie inspired by Mother Monster.

The packaging is bright pink and comes with a bold "LADY GAGA" in a shiny mirror finish splashed across the front. Copy reads, "This is a cookie inspired by Chromatica," with the album title stylized. Minimal Oreo branding appears on the top, and inside, the cookies are pink-colored and stamped with imagery from Gaga’s latest work. The inner filling, though green in color, tastes like the original creme flavored, at least we hope.

"This collab is inspired by the world of Chromatica, where kindness rules all things," said Lady Gaga in an announcement about the colorful cookies. "I love these pink cookies with green creme, and hope they brighten your day as much as they do mine!”

The brand told Adweek that the cookies would launch officially in 2021, with 6-cookie packs appearing in convenience stores in January. Fans were directed to LadyGagaOreoStanClub.com to receive updates and details, with the first 1,000 getting in front of the line for the new cookies. In the meantime, starting December 15th, the collaboration launches Sing it with Oreo, which will allow fans to share musical greetings with friends.
